Symbolism of about the Cat in dreams
When you dream about a cat, it often has a deeper meaning. Dreams can show your feelings and thoughts. Let's see what dreaming about a cat might mean to you.
General meaning of dreaming about the Cat
Cats in dreams often symbolize independence, mystery and curiosity. When you dream about cats, it can mean different things depending on the context. Cats might represent your desire for freedom or your curious nature. They can also indicate hidden parts of your life that you are not fully aware of.
Here is a table to help you understand the various meanings:
Context of the Cat's Dream | Possible Interpretation | Emotional Impact |
---|---|---|
Friendly Cat | Comfort and companionship | Positive |
Aggressive Cat | Conflict or hidden fears | Negative |
Stray Cat | Independence or feeling lost | Mixed |
More Cats | Chaos or many opportunities | Oppressive or exciting |
To dream of a friendly cat can bring feelings of comfort. It suggests that you are in a good place with your social relationships. An aggressive cat, on the other hand, might indicate conflicts or fears that you need to face.
A stray cat may reflect your independent spirit or a sense of loss. Finally, multiple cats in a dream may indicate feeling overwhelmed or having many choices to consider. Understanding these symbols can help you better interpret your dreams and what they might tell you about your waking life.

Cat attacking you
You may find yourself dreaming that you are being attacked by a cat in various ways. Perhaps the cat is scratching you. It may also be biting or hissing. These dreams can be quite frightening. They often leave you with an uneasy feeling. But what do they mean?
A cat attacking you in a dream can symbolize conflict. You may find yourself facing problems in your life. These issues could involve friends, family members, or colleagues. It could also mean that you feel threatened by something. This could be a situation or a person.
Sometimes, these dreams show your inner struggles. You may be struggling with stress or anxiety. The attacking cat represents those feelings. It is your mind's way of showing you that something is wrong. You may have to deal with these issues.
It is also possible that the cat represents your aggression. You may be holding back anger. This dream is a reminder to Get rid of those feelings. Find a healthy way of dealing with them.

How do cultural beliefs influence the interpretation of cat dreams?
Cultural beliefs really shape how cat dreams are interpreted. In some cultures, cats are seen as symbols of mystery or independence. In others, they might signify bad luck or even good fortune. Your background and experiences will color how you interpret these dreams. So if you dream of a cat, think about what cats mean in your culture. It may help you better understand the dream.
